Oracle PL/SQL CURSOR カーソル part3 FOR LOOP

Oracle において PL/SQL CURSOR カーソル とは以下を示します。

  1. カーソル FOR LOOP
     set serveroutput on ;
    
     DECLARE
       -- カーソル宣言
       CURSOR c_emp IS SELECT emp_code, emp_name FROM m_emp ;
     BEGIN
       -- 繰り返しの処理
       FOR wk_rec_emp IN c_emp LOOP
         -- 表示
         DBMS_OUTPUT.PUT_LINE( '-------------------------' ) ;
         DBMS_OUTPUT.PUT_LINE( wk_rec_emp.emp_code ) ;
         DBMS_OUTPUT.PUT_LINE( wk_rec_emp.emp_name ) ;
       END LOOP ;
     END ;
     /
    

http://www.bishounen.sakura.ne.jp/rails/images/knowledge/88_02_cursor_for_loop.jpg

ご訪問頂き有難う御座います。 当サイトを効率良く使うためにまずは FrontPage を見て下さい。 検索方法、一覧表示などの各情報を纏めています。
当サイトの説明 → Frontpage